It seems the current draft does not discuss HttpOnly cookies and other
headers that implementations may not want to expose. Can we have a Se-
curity Considerations section that clarifies that implementations may,
at their discretion, not expose certain headers, perhaps giving Http-
Only cookies as an example where that may be desired? I would expect any
future HttpOnly cookie specification to discuss its relationship with
XmlHTTPRequest in more detail, so I don't think we should include more
of it than citing it as example.

I added this:

  http://dev.w3.org/2006/webapi/XMLHttpRequest/#security
